Pilates Benefits
Pilates benefits have long been known in the dance community. Ballerinas and modern dancers that have long, strong legs and tight bellies have been doing Pilates for decades. Pilates was brought to the U.S in the late 1920’s by the man that created the exercises and remained a beautiful secret of sorts, for many decades.
These days there are Pilates magazines, videos and classes everywhere and with good reason. Pilates is a wonderful set of exercises that work to sculpt the body without bulking up.

Pilates benefits are plentiful. By maintaining a neutral spine and shoulder stability, the rest of the body will be strengthened. Pilates benefits are immense because they are a total body workout.
Pilates is a great mind-body exercise that works to transform the way that the body looks and feels. Joseph Pilates, the founder, believed that people are injured or become sick because there are imbalances in their bodies. By building up strength and flexibility in all parts of the body, people strength their immune systems and the entire body.
Pilates benefits include maintaining a strong, flat abdomen. Everyone wants a sleek, flat stomach. Pilates also help prevent injuries and illness by working to make the whole body strong and stable. Another wonderful Pilates benefits is the they keep you constantly challenged.
